Transaction 075052dadea2a144cfab2841d5e8b732a0462efc8e651963420f29a8036b0395
1 Input
1 Output
-
075052dadea2a144cfab2841d5e8b732a0462efc8e651963420f29a8036b0395:0
- value
- 30256517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80a151083a9cacb4942299edbf5d259f8d406b6f OP_EQUAL
- address
- 3DR9fZrERei7p3GJ1qS28wzyay8esgcaSd